Summary: This position requires strict adherence to current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MPs), established cleaning practices and procedures, and compliance with quality standards and regulations. The purpose of the cleaning and sanitization program is to control contamination and to serve as a corrective action for the loss of control for excursion contamination.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) must be followed and strictly enforced to ensure acceptable environmental monitoring results of the cleaned GMP environment.

Essential duties and responsibilities: Include any or all of the following. Other duties may be assigned.
● Responsible for routine daily, weekly, monthly, and quarterly room sanitization in GMP process areas
● Responsible for non-routine sanitization in the GMP process areas due to the environmental excursion, process requirements, or facility maintenance and construction
● Responsible for verifying that the proper sanitization agent rotation is followed, proper labelling, including expirations and GDP, and that the appropriate sanitization agent is used for each cleaning assignment
● Responsible for completing required GMP, GDP, and ALCOA documentation to ensure records are accurately and adequately maintained contemporaneously
● Responsible for mixing and disposal of sanitization solutions on a daily basis
● Responsible for the disposal of waste from GMP manufacturing process area waste receptacles on a regular basis
● Responsible for collecting full, soiled gowning article bags on a daily basis, and replacing with new bags
● Responsible for ordering general manufacturing supplies such as but not limited to clean room wipes, gloves, face masks, hairnets, shoe covers, cleaning agents, etc.
● Responsible for stocking and maintaining GMP manufacturing process areas with gloves, face masks, hairnets, laundered and disposable gowning articles, and sanitizing equipment and supplies
● Responsible for organization and upkeep of sanitization supply areas and general manufacturing supply areas
● Responsible for organization and distribution of gowning items (laundered and disposable) within the GMP manufacturing process areas on a daily basis to ensure proper inventory levels
● Responsible for participating in cycle counting and inventory of sanitization supplies and gowning articles in order to maintain inventory levels for timely reordering
